CHILDREN’S REGISTERED MANAGER REQUIREDAbout the serviceThis is an established 6 bedded service in the Cambridgeshire area, caring for a group of children/young people aged 8-18 who have complex social & emotional and mental health needs who require mid to long term placements.The new manager will be instrumental in the development and running of the home including gaining new referrals, staff management and ensuring that OFSTED ratings are OUTSTANDING.This role attracts bonus related pay quarterly alongside your annual salary which equates to £60,000paWe require a driven manager with passion, who can lead the service towards exceptional levels and can clearly evidence positive outcomes for young people

  • You will need to be highly motivated and committed to delivering focused services to young people in an evolving environment, demonstrating the skills necessary to manage the organisational systems involved.
  • The successful applicant will need to have had a wide range of experience as a child care practitioner with experience of managing teams in a residential setting with ideally a good or outstanding rated service.
  • Enthusiastic, resilient with a great personality youll have the judgement to make key decisions and will be able to inspire, develop and grow an exceptional team around you.
  • You must be prepared to work hard and build a committed team through this period of growth and development.
  • Personal Qualities needed:
  • Vision, creativity and innovation
  • Tolerance & resilience
  • Professional assertiveness
  • Good organisational & time management skills
  • Reflective skills
  • An accessible, approachable & participative management style
  • Awareness of own values and beliefs & confidence in own skills with Equal Opportunities
  • A commitment to work in an anti-discriminatory non-judgemental
  • Enthusiasm and commitment to the childrens protection & development
  • A good sense of humour, initiative, integrity & honesty
